Chert is a hard and compact sedimentary rock, consisting dominantly of very small quartz crystals. Chert occurs mostly in carbonate sedimentary rocks as nodules or layers. Flint is a dark-colored variety of chert.^ Coal is a combustible rock containing more than 50% by weight of carbonaceous material. Coal in most cases is a lithified peat.

The lithology of a rock unit is a description of its physical characteristics visible at outcrop, in hand or core samples, or with low magnification microscopy. Physical characteristics include colour, texture, grain size, and composition. Limestone is a sedimentary rock composed primarily of calcite, a calcium carbonate mineral with a chemical composition of CaCO 3. It usually forms in clear, calm, warm, shallow marine waters. Limestone is usually a biological sedimentary rock, forming from the accumulation of shell, coral, algal, fecal, and other organic debris.

The simplest way of classifying coarse clastic sedimentary rocks is to name the rock and include a brief description of its particular characteristics. Conglomerates and breccias differ from one another only in clast angularity. The former consist of abraded, somewhat rounded, coarse clasts, whereas the latter contain angular, coarse clasts. Clastic sedimentary rocks are primarily classified by their grain size through the use of the 'Wentworth Scale'. This scale simply gives concrete definitions to what size particles are considered a 'sand', 'clay', or 'boulder', for example.

Distribution of Se in metamorphic and sedimentary rocks (Table 1) reveals that among sedimentary rocks, shales generally contain more Se than sandstone, limestone, and phosphate rocks. Values are the lowest in pure sandstone and carbonate rocks which are primarily quartz, feldspars, and carbonates. A clastic sedimentary rock. As its name implies, it is primarily composed of silt sized particles, defined as grains < 0.06mm. Siltstones differ significantly from sandstones due to the smaller spaces available between the grains (pore space) and often contain a significant amount of clay. Slate: Slate is formed from low grade regional metamorphism of fine grained sedimentary mudrocks. It is a homogeneous fine grained rock which can be split into thin or thick sheets with relatively smooth surfaces.
